Description

This hymn, with words by William W. Walford from around 1842 and a melody by W. B. Bradbury that was first associated with the hymn in 1859, has become a staple of Protestant church services over the past century-and-a-half. This performance by David Schnaufer and Zada Law is performed on a so-called "courting dulcimer" that sports two fretboards for two people to play simultaneously.
